Is Matthew Stafford [Throwing Gold] #430 worth grading?
Football · Football Cards 2009 Topps · full price guide →
Worth grading — even a PSA 9 beats raw
A PSA 10 Matthew Stafford [Throwing Gold] #430 sells for $377 against $95.17 raw: a $282 spread, 4.0× the ungraded price. Even a PSA 9 ($154) clears the raw price after an economy-tier ~$25 fee, so a near-miss still comes out ahead. Centering is the usual reason a clean copy misses the 10 — measure it before you submit.

Break-even by outcome and fee
| If it comes back… | Sells for | Economy / bulk (~$25.00) | Standard (~$50.00) | Express (~$150)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Gem — PSA 10 | $377 | +$257 | +$232 | +$132 |
| PSA 9 | $154 | +$33.83 | +$8.83 | −$91.17 |
| PSA 8 | $140 | +$20.12 | −$4.88 | −$105 |
Net = sale price − $95.17 raw value − fee. Fee tiers are illustrative; plug your grader's current price into the calculator below.

Which grader pays the most — and what a 10 takes
All centering standards →| Grader | 10 sells for | vs best | Front centering for a 10 | Back |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| BGS 10 | $490 | best | 55/45 | 70/30 |
| SGC 10 | $450 | −$40.00 | 55/45 | 75/25 |
| PSA 10 | $377 | −$113 | 55/45 | 75/25 |
| CGC 10 | $226 | −$264 | 55/45 | 75/25 |
Tolerances are each company's published centering standard for its top grade; surface, corners and edges must also be clean. Centering is the one you can measure yourself before you pay.
